In a bold move to reclaim their dominance on the track, Ferrari has unveiled a groundbreaking aerodynamic upgrade during the Austrian Grand Prix. This significant modification comes after a series of setbacks that exposed critical weaknesses in the SF-25, prompting the Italian team to take drastic action.
The revamped design, which has been in the works since just four races into the season, represents a radical departure from conventional setups. By opting for a pull rod suspension system at the front instead of the traditional push rod, Ferrari has pushed the boundaries of innovation to enhance performance.
However, this daring approach came with its own set of challenges. The height of the base plate and the tuning of the car’s setup raised concerns about stability and aerodynamic efficiency. The clash between maximizing downforce and rear suspension limitations led to issues with excessive wear and compromised performance on the track.
To address these critical flaws, Ferrari’s technical team, led by team principal Fred Vasseur, introduced a new floor at the Red Bull Ring. This upgrade is not just about a quick fix but a strategic step towards creating a more balanced and predictable driving experience for their star drivers, Lewis Hamilton and Charles Leclerc.
